3 Power Levels
One of the major differences between the BF-F8HP and the other members of the UV-5R series is that it comes with three power settings instead of two. While the original model has a maximum power output of 4W, this one offers 8W, which is double the amount.
To be specific, with the BF-F8HP, you get 1W, 4W, and 8W power outputs. You can set the device to any one of these depending on the kind of performance you want to achieve.
But setting the power low allows you to conserve the battery life. Thus, you should only set the radio to full capacity when there’s a need to, or else you will end up replacing the battery sooner.
Wide Frequency Range
With the BaoFeng BF-F8HP, you will get access to a wide range of frequencies – from 65 to 108 MHz, which is quite satisfactory for its price. However, this range is only for commercial FM radio reception.
That said, you can also tune into UHF (400-520 MHz) and VHF (136-174 MHz).
We found the receiver’s sensitivity to be quite impressive. Though we wish we could say the same for the selectivity, that’s not the case. The performance is a little less than average. In normal open areas, the lack of filtering is not usually an issue; however, in areas with much RF activity, this might become apparent.

30-Percent Larger Battery
Compared with the original model, the BF-F8HP comes with a battery that is 30% larger. So, if you were not impressed with the charge provided by the previous series, you could be comforted to know you’re getting more with the BF-F8HP.
To be more specific, the battery is rated around 2000mAh on a full charge, which simply translates to more time for your radio. Thus, you can extend your radio activities or operations, knowing you have a battery you can bank on.
The average battery life is around 20 – 24 hours, which is enough to last you the whole day. With less power output, the radio can even last longer. Thus, there’s no need to carry a charger if you plan to spend just a day out.

Frequently Asked Questions About BF-F8HP
Can I use privacy code on this device?
Yes, you can. The BF-F8HP comes with CTCSS/DCS encoding, which allows you to use privacy code on your communication channel.
Does this have channel scan?
Luckily, it does –another reason you should get this unit.
What is included in the product package?
Apart from the radio, the other things you will find in the package include hand strap, belt clip, battery pack, desktop charger, earphone, antenna, and manual.
Does this come with a programming cable?
No. You will have to purchase this separately. We advise getting an original BaoFeng cable to avoid compatibility issues.
